The definition of 'fantasy' being not necessarily 'it has elves and/or mages', but rather broader.

Oddly, although I've enjoyed fantasy novels for many years, I don't read and love a vast amount of Fantasy within popslash—and I've written at least two that would qualify as such. However, I think my choice for today's category fits the label, in that it is a world which doesn't now and never did exist.

Temperance by [personal profile] nopseud. I was present as this story was conceived—indeed, I provided the, er, spark, although only by proxy, as I was bewailing the prompt I'd received for that year's MTYG (2009), which was 'post-apocalypse with vampires and romance'. I have to admit, the concept of vampires running a tea shop would not have occurred to me, but Nopseud was very excited about it, and the resultant story is atmospheric, convincing and highly readable.

There are a couple of follow-up stories, too: Providence and honesty.


Sadly, I put my response to this MTYG prompt (for this world to be unbroken) onto my list last year, so I won't use it here. Instead, have a more conventionally 'fantasy' world in Tribute, written for my own Dragon Challenge in 2008. In which there is a dragon in the sky, and someone has to be sacrificed.
